The Henn Connector Group bundles and expands services

With the merger of the companies UFT, TKW and VMR to form "Henngineered" in July 2023, the parent company, the Austrian Henn Connector Group, is combining valuable expertise and services under one roof. This step enables the company to offer its customers an even broader materials and technology portfolio as well as more comprehensive support along the entire value chain.

Everything from a single source - the Henn Connector Group describes the introduction of the "Henngineered" brand as a milestone in its company history. The merger of various manufacturing service providers - all of which are subsidiaries of the Henn Connector Group - brings together numerous technological competencies: metal deep-drawing (UFT Produktion GmbH), plastic injection moulding (TKW Molding GmbH, TKW Plastics) and 3D printing (VMR GmbH & Co KG), to name just the most important.In addition to this wide range of manufacturing processes for plastics and metal processing, customers also find Henngineered to be an ideal industrialization partner that provides them with detailed advice and support throughout the entire development and manufacturing process. Thanks to these bundled services, many interfaces are eliminated and tailor-made solutions can be realized for the customer. "With the joint appearance as Henngineered, we offer our customers an even broader range of materials and technologies as well as comprehensive support," emphasizes Henngineered CEO Christoph Jandl. "This further development not only strengthens our leading position in the industry, but also creates space for the future positive development of our location regions."

3D printing, thermoforming, plastic injection molding

Henngineered offers a wide range of manufacturing technologies and materials under one roof. The portfolio includes plastic injection molding, turning and milling, metal deep-drawing, 3D printing in metal and plastic, vacuum and polyamide casting and other shaping technologies. All production sites are also certified to at least the ISO 9001:2015 quality standard.

The brand is represented at five locations worldwide. Special solutions for automation are developed in Dornbirn, Austria. The German sites include Mönchweiler with its competence center and innovation hub for additive manufacturing. Prototypes and small series are manufactured here. The services also include vacuum casting, machining, toolmaking and injection molding.

The production center for deep-drawing metal parts is located in Heinsdorfergrund. Here, 12 deep-drawing presses with press forces of up to 3,000 kN form around 50 million automotive parts per year, including quick-release fasteners, airbag sleeves, exhaust sensor parts, cooling connections and camshaft sensor rings.

The two production centers for plastic injection moulding are located in Blankenhain, Germany, and Taicang, China. They primarily produce parts for the automotive sector, including airbag covers, brake fluid reservoirs and components for seat belt systems. Henngineered has a total of 86 injection molding machines at both sites.

Leading the way in additive manufacturing

Henngineered is one of the industry leaders in the field of additive manufacturing. The competence center for additive manufacturing in Mönchweiler has been optimized so that the 3D-printed plastic and metal parts are ready for delivery in three to five days, and Henngineered has a special offering that sets it apart from the competition: subsequent heat treatment, blasting and CNC machining in-house - even in series. Various printing processes for plastics are also offered. For higher requirements such as high-gloss surfaces, fine structures, crystal-clear parts, temperature resistance or glass fiber reinforcement, Henngineered offers vacuum casting as a solution: Thanks to low tooling costs and short lead times, initial parts are available in under ten working days, and even near-series parts can be produced in polyamide casting.

Machining and toolmaking are also among the areas of expertise in Mönchweiler. Even difficult-to-machine or hardened metal is machined here. 3D-printed metal parts can be reworked, and assembly production and surface coating are also offered.

From the idea to mass production

In addition to the expanded material and technology portfolio, Henngineered offers its customers comprehensive services along the entire process chain. It all starts with expert advice: Which material and which production technology are suitable for implementing the customer's requirements? What is the right component design for prototypes, pilot series and series production? How can quality be ensured throughout the process and how can sub-processes be optimized with foresight? By involving the customer in the engineering process, concrete planning is created from an idea within a very short time. In addition, all manufacturing processes can be simulated in advance for precise design.

For prototype production (possible from one piece), Henngineered can draw on a wide range of qualities, materials and technologies. Thanks to predictive optimization, prototype assemblies can be produced that hardly differ from series production. This increases productivity and reduces development and production costs. Series production is also part of Henngineered's range of services. The service providers, now operating under the same name, have many years of experience in mass production. Over 50 million assembly units - or a total of 200 million parts - of the highest precision and quality are produced annually and deep-drawn parts, plastic parts and other components are assembled fully automatically.

Henngineered also supports its customers in the after-sales area, for example by producing small batches retrospectively, keeping spare parts in stock or procuring them, storing tools and developing new products together with them. Finally, Henngineered also offers a wide range of quality assurance measures, from audits to claim management.

Thanks to the combination of valuable skills and services, Henngineered can offer its customers a complete solution and support projects from the initial idea through design to large-scale production. The reduction of interfaces and bureaucracy results in shorter decision-making processes. The available resources and technologies are pooled, which also saves time and money. In addition, this holistic approach increases the quality of products across the entire value chain.
